DOLE Launches Investigation into Marikina Gun Factory Explosion

Marikina city: The Department of Labor and Employment (DOLE) has initiated a probe into the explosion at a gun manufacturing company located in Barangay Fortune, Marikina City. The incident, which occurred on Monday, resulted in the death of two workers and left another injured.

According to Philippines News Agency, DOLE Secretary Bienvenido Laguesma has tasked the DOLE-NCR (National Capital Region) with the investigation to provide assistance to the affected workers and develop recommendations to prevent future incidents. "The health and safety of all workers are first and foremost the serious concern of the DOLE, particularly in companies where the hazards and risks to workers' life are high," Laguesma stated in a telephone interview.

Laguesma indicated that a Work Stoppage Order might be considered against the facility, contingent upon the investigation's findings. "That will be part of the action that can be taken by the DOLE-NCR, if warranted," he added.

Initial findings by the Marikina City Police pointed out that the explosion was triggered by a box containing primer that detonated unexpectedly inside the factory.
